MAMARONECK, NY — Star Students are found in classrooms, on concert and theater stages and at debate lecterns, and out in the community doing good things to make life better for all of us.

Here at Patch, we've launched an initiative to help recognize Star Students, and we’re working to tell the stories of these outstanding kids to their neighbors.

This submission comes from Patrick who nominated Luke, 12th Grade, of Larchmont-Mamaroneck. With the successes this star student has under his belt, it would be easy to give into vanity, but Luke not only remains humble, he takes pride in helping others to find their own paths to success.

Why do you believe the star local student should be recognized?

Luke seems to have that unique [ability] that allows him to exist in multiple spheres with comfort, yet somehow defies typical stereotypes while thriving.

SCHOOL- A Senior at Rye Neck HS, Luke is viewed as an influencer and alpha but his interests and actions don't follow a typical path. He is a High Honor Roll student with a 94.9 avg, and earned a scholarship with early admission to Muhlenberg College. At the same time, he is a major athlete, being a captain in multiple sports and being a school record holder.

VOLUNTEERING- Luke has amassed hundreds of hours during his high school career volunteering at various locations. He coaches 4th graders in the local basketball league. He works as a counselor at a summer camp for underprivileged youth. He is a Youth Deacon and teaches Sunday School at his church. And he founded a camp during COVID for neighborhood boys so they could have a social and physical outlet.

SCHOOL SPIRIT- There are not many top athletes who sneak into the mascot costume to cheer on their fellow schoolmates after their game is over. But Luke wore the Panther costume to get crowds fired up this fall.

ATHLETICS- A top lacrosse player who owns multiple school records, led his team a League title, and is the first player in school history to be named All-Section for NY Section 1, Luke loves Rye Neck sports! He also was named All-League in basketball, helping the team to its best record in decades. His leadership is crucial to his teams as he was named captain in both sports this year.

CAUSES- Luke cares about his community being welcoming and fair to all. He participated in BLM and anti-gun violence rallies. More importantly, he helps underclassmen with a Senior-Buddy mentor program.
